Finding the Perfect Area rug to Ground Your Art Deco Living Room with Velvet
When choosing an area rug to enhance your Art deco living room, consider how the rug complements the sumptuous texture of velvet. Look for geometric patterns that echo the bold lines and symmetry characteristic of the Art Deco movement.These designs not only unify the space but also create a striking contrast to the plushness of your velvet sofa. Additionally, color coordination is key; opt for a rug that resonates with the rich jewel tones or metallic accents often found in Art Deco decor. Here are some popular choices:
- Abstract patterns: brings a modern twist to a classic aesthetic.
- Bold colors: makes a statement without overwhelming the decor.
- Textured fibers: adds depth while providing a tactile contrast to soft velvet.
Size matters when grounding your living room’s design. An appropriately sized rug can anchor your seating area and enhance the overall flow of the space. A large area rug should extend at least a few inches under the front legs of your sofa, which will help define the seating zone while maintaining visual continuity. Alternatively, consider layering smaller rugs for an eclectic appearance that still honors the vintage charm of the era. Below is a simple reference to help with sizing:
Rug Size | Ideal Room Size |
---|---|
5’x8′ | Small living areas |
8’x10′ | Medium spaces |
9’x12′ | Large living rooms |

Exploring Velvet Texture Varieties for personalized Art Deco Living Room Designs
when curating an Art Deco living room, the selection of velvet textures can significantly elevate the overall aesthetics and comfort of the space. Velvet, with its luxurious appearance, offers a variety of finishes that can complement the geometric lines and rich hues characteristic of the Art Deco movement.Consider these velvet texture options to inspire your design choices:
- Shimmer Velvet: The subtle sheen emanating from shimmer velvet adds a touch of glam, perfect for accent pieces like cushions or ottomans.
- Crushed Velvet: This texture delivers a dynamic visual impact,providing an intriguing contrast against smooth surfaces in your room.
- Tufted Velvet: A tufted velvet sofa not only offers plush seating but also enhances the richness of the design, making it a statement piece.
- Plain Velvet: Ideal for those seeking a sleek and timeless look, plain velvet is versatile and seamlessly blends with bold Art Deco patterns.
Integrating these different textures allows for unique personalization while ensuring coherence within your Art Deco theme.For a well-rounded approach, juxtapose textures in a color palette that reflects the elegance of the era. Below is a suggested color combination table for enhanced inspiration:
Texture | Palette Suggestions |
---|---|
Shimmer Velvet | Gold, Deep teal |
Crushed Velvet | Burgundy, Black |
Tufted velvet | Emerald Green, Cream |
Plain Velvet | Navy, Blush Pink |

Elegantly Arranging Velvet Sofas: layout Ideas for Cohesive Art Deco Spaces
When styling a living room in a glamorous Art Deco theme, the arrangement of velvet sofas plays a crucial role in establishing an inviting and cohesive atmosphere. Start by centering a sumptuous,deep-colored velvet sofa against a striking feature wall,such as a mural or geometric wallpaper. This not only creates a focal point but also allows the rich texture of the fabric to shine. Flank it with two chic armchairs that complement the sofa’s color, perhaps in lighter tones or with bold patterns that echo the geometric motifs typical of the era. To enhance the visual harmony, consider using a large, plush area rug that ties together the seating arrangement, adding warmth and comfort underfoot.
Along with the main seating area, accentuate your velvet sofas with stylish side tables and statement lighting. Opt for gold or brass-finished side tables that reflect the opulence of the Art Deco period and set them beside each armchair for functionality.For lighting,choose elegantly designed floor lamps or chandeliers that illuminate the space with a warm glow while emphasizing the room’s sophisticated character. Lastly, accessorize with vibrantly colored cushions and throws in luxurious fabrics to add layers of texture, ensuring that your living space is not only cohesive but also inviting and distinctively Art Deco.
